In Exercises 1–6, find (a) |A|, (b) |B|, (c) |AB|, and (d) |AB|. Then verify that |A| |B| = |AB|.

\(A=\left[\begin{array}{rrr}

-1 & 2 & 1 \\

1 & 0 & 1 \\

0 & 1 & 0

\end{array}\right], \quad B=\left[\begin{array}{rrr}

-1 & 0 & 0 \\

0 & 2 & 0 \\

0 & 0 & 3

\end{array}\right]\)
